RCRC Urges Obama to Fill Upcoming Court Vacancy With Reproductive Rights Supporter
Major news sources are reporting that U.S. Supreme Court Justice David Souter will announce his retirement at the end of the court's term in June. As a faithful advocate for women and families, the Religious Coalition for Reproductive Choice urges President Obama to replace the liberal Souter with another consistent supporter of reproductive rights.
